WCAG(웹 콘텐츠 접근성 가이드라인)는 시각, 청각, 운동, 인지 장애를 포함한 장애인이 웹 및 SaaS 제품을 사용할 수 있도록 하는 국제적으로 인정된 표준입니다. B2B SaaS 기업의 경우, WCAG 2.1 AA 준수는 점점 더 많은 관할권에서 조달 요구사항이자 법적 의무가 되고 있습니다.
?
WCAG의 네 가지 원칙은 무엇이며, 실제로는 무엇을 요구하나요?
WCAG 2.1은 POUR이라는 약어로 기억되는 네 가지 원칙을 중심으로 구성됩니다. 인식 가능(Perceivable): 사용자는 모든 정보와 UI 구성 요소를 최소한 하나의 감각을 통해 인식할 수 있어야 합니다. 요구사항: 모든 이미지에는 설명적인 대체 텍스트가 있어야 합니다. 모든 비디오 콘텐츠에는 캡션이 있어야 합니다. 색상이 정보를 전달하는 유일한 방법이 아니어야 합니다(예: 오류 상태는 빨간색 외에 텍스트나 아이콘을 사용). 텍스트는 배경과 충분한 색상 대비를 유지해야 합니다(일반 텍스트는 4.5:1, AA 준수 기준 큰 텍스트는 3:1). 운용 가능(Operable): 모든 기능은 키보드만으로 조작 가능해야 합니다(마우스를 사용할 수 없는 운동 장애 사용자는 Tab, Enter, 화살표 키, Escape를 사용하여 모든 워크플로를 탐색, 활성화 및 완료할 수 있어야 합니다). 요구사항: 포커스 상태가 명확하게 보여야 합니다. 키보드 트랩이 없어야 합니다(사용자는 항상 모든 UI 요소에서 벗어날 수 있어야 합니다). 스크린 리더 사용자를 위한 건너뛰기 탐색 링크가 있어야 합니다. 이해 가능(Understandable): 인터페이스는 언어, 동작 및 오류 처리 측면에서 이해 가능해야 합니다. 요구사항: 페이지 언어가 HTML에 지정되어야 합니다. 양식 필드에는 보이는 레이블이 있어야 합니다. 오류 메시지는 무엇이 잘못되었는지, 어떻게 수정해야 하는지 명확하게 식별해야 합니다. UI 동작은 예측 가능해야 합니다(포커스 시 예기치 않은 컨텍스트 변경이 없어야 합니다). 견고함(Robust): 콘텐츠는 보조 기술에 의해 안정적으로 해석될 수 있어야 합니다. 요구사항: 시맨틱 HTML(제목 계층, 랜드마크 요소, ARIA 역할을 적절하게 사용). 양식 요소에는 관련 레이블이 있어야 합니다. 사용자 지정 대화형 구성 요소는 올바른 ARIA 패턴을 구현해야 합니다.
?
제품 팀은 제품 전반에 걸쳐 접근성 준수를 어떻게 테스트해야 하나요?
접근성 테스트는 자동 스캐닝과 수동 테스트를 조합해야 합니다. 자동화 도구는 WCAG 문제의 약 30~40%를 찾아내고, 보조 기술 및 장애인 사용자 연구를 통한 수동 테스트가 나머지를 찾아냅니다. 자동 테스트 도구: Axe(브라우저 확장 프로그램 + CI 통합 — 가장 널리 사용되고 정확한 자동화 도구); WAVE(WebAIM의 브라우저 확장 프로그램 — 문제의 시각적 주석에 유용); Lighthouse(Chrome DevTools에 내장 — 접근성 감사 포함). 자동 테스트는 모든 풀 리퀘스트에서 CI 파이프라인에서 실행되어야 하며, 새로운 접근성 위반이 발생하면 빌드를 실패시켜야 합니다. 수동 테스트 프로토콜: 키보드 탐색 감사(키보드만 사용하여 모든 워크플로 탐색 — Tab으로 앞으로 이동, Shift+Tab으로 뒤로 이동, Enter/Space로 활성화, Escape로 닫기). 모든 트랩이나 깨진 경로를 문서화합니다. 스크린 리더 테스트: NVDA + Firefox(Windows, 무료) 및 VoiceOver + Safari(macOS, 내장)로 테스트합니다. 핵심 사용자 흐름을 탐색하고 올바르게 발표되지 않거나, 컨텍스트가 누락되었거나, 혼란을 야기하는 요소를 식별합니다. 색상 대비 확인: 디자인 시스템 및 제품의 모든 텍스트/배경 조합에 대해 색상 대비 분석 도구(ColorContrastChecker, Colour Contrast Analyser 앱)를 사용합니다. 장애인 사용자 테스트: 관련 장애(시각, 운동, 인지)를 가진 2~3명의 사용자와 분기별 유용성 세션을 통해 자동화 도구가 생성할 수 없는 정성적 통찰력을 얻습니다.
?
VPAT은 무엇이며, 엔터프라이즈 B2B 판매에 왜 필요한가요?
VPAT(Voluntary Product Accessibility Template)는 ITI(Information Technology Industry Council)에서 발행하는 표준화된 문서로, 제품이 각 WCAG 2.1 기준 및 섹션 508 요구사항(미국 연방 접근성 법률)을 어떻게 충족하는지 설명합니다. 엔터프라이즈 및 정부 조달 팀은 공급업체 평가의 일환으로 완성된 VPAT(공식적으로는 ACR, Accessibility Conformance Report라고 함)를 요구합니다. VPAT 없이는 많은 정부, 의료, 금융 서비스 및 교육 부문 거래가 자동으로 실격 처리됩니다. 이는 접근성을 위한 보안 설문지라고 할 수 있습니다. VPAT 섹션: 각 WCAG 성공 기준에 대해 VPAT은 다음을 기록합니다. 지원(Supports, 제품이 기준을 완전히 충족함); 부분 지원(Partially Supports, 제품이 일부 요구사항은 충족하지만 전부는 아님, 설명 포함); 미지원(Does Not Support, 제품이 이 기준을 충족하지 않음, 설명 포함); 해당 없음(Not Applicable, 이 기준이 이 제품 유형에 적용되지 않음). VPAT의 정직성과 정확성: 제품이 충족하지 않는 기준에 대해 '지원'을 주장하는 VPAT은 법적 책임이 있습니다. VPAT은 접근성 감사 결과(자동 + 수동 테스트)와 법률 검토를 조합하여 준비되어야 합니다. Product Ops는 VPAT 작성을 조율합니다. 감사를 위해 외부 접근성 컨설턴트를 참여시키고, 검토를 위해 법무팀을 참여시키며, 제품 변경에 따라 분기별 업데이트 주기를 유지합니다(업데이트 없이 12개월 이상 된 VPAT은 조달 팀에서 신뢰할 수 없는 것으로 간주합니다).
지식 챌린지
웹 접근성 및 WCAG 표준을(를) 마스터하셨나요? 이제 관련된 6글자 단어를 맞춰보세요!
입력하거나 키보드를 사용하세요